Is Bethany Lake low for this time of year?

Compared with every June in our records, the current level is higher than 7% of them — low for this time of year. Seasonal comparison matters more than the raw number, because most reservoirs draw down predictably through late summer and refill over winter and spring.

Why is Bethany Lake low right now?

Reservoir levels move for four main reasons: rainfall and runoff into the basin, releases through the dam for downstream water supply, power generation or flood control, evaporation during hot months, and seasonal drawdown schedules set by the operating agency.
